  • Patent number: 11954483
    Abstract: A method for updating software in one or more servers in a managed system includes bootstrapping of shared secrets to secure communication, using an object store with publicly accessible URLs as a mailbox system between a patch agent locally at the managed system and a patch management server located remotely. The object store provides for indirect and asynchronous communication, allowing the patch management server to manage the updates, whereas the patch agent executes the updates. The patch management server keeps track of update results, and when an update is unsuccessful it performs and supports a remediation process. Both the patch agent and the patch management server keep full logs of the update results to allow for auditing.

  • Patent number: 10664309
    Abstract: Concurrent processing of objects is scheduled using time buckets of different time bucket generations. A time bucket generation includes a configuration for time buckets associated with that time bucket generation. The concurrent use of different time bucket generations includes the concurrent processing of objects referenced by time buckets of different time bucket generations.
